Links are NOT allowed. Format your description nicely so people can easily read them. Please use proper spacing and paragraphs.The world is full of mysteries. Strange, seemingly unexplainable events occur more often than we may realize. A young boy may catch an illness no doctor can explain. An office may catch fire for no apparent reason. And perhaps, someone may die a sudden and unexpected death – their bodies blighted beyond recognition.
Some might believe that these events are merely freak accidents.
However, Ye Shaoyang knows otherwise.
The youngest inner disciple ever in the prestigious Daoist Maoshan Sect. Talented, handsome, and a hillbilly from the mountains who still uses a brick phone in the modern age.
Follow the tale of our quirky, snippy, but honorable hero, after he finally descends the mountains after fifteen years of being out of touch with normal society. Read on as he combats horrifying apparitions, charms ladies, and finds himself in all sorts of trouble along the way!
A story that delves into Daoism, Chinese sorcery, and the supernatural from Asian mythology.
